Output 623ef161e31f33ba968ccddc7232ec324cdd3b896c72b3a0988d99986a84b625:1

value
258334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13540b80799cc8e84aca7fb05fbcd7f8522fce4f OP_EQUALVERIFY OP_CHECKSIG
address
12mCXBxDXSCoHaPc7DZ9q9eHNJX1V9FQ39
transaction
623ef161e31f33ba968ccddc7232ec324cdd3b896c72b3a0988d99986a84b625
spent
true